centripetal forced or moving inward toward a center point or axis.
deposition a sworn statement, usually in writing, for use as testimony by an absent witness in a court of law.
descant a secondary, usually higher, melody that is played or sung at the same time as the chief melody.
distraught mentally or emotionally unbalanced; crazed.
exceptionable likely to be objected to; objectionable.
froward unwilling to agree or obey; stubborn; perverse.
gamut the whole extent or range of anything.
inchoate partially or imperfectly developed.
indomitable too strong to be subdued or discouraged; unconquerable.
insipid having a bland or uninteresting flavor; tasteless.
lenitive mitigating pain, discomfort, or distress; soothing.
luminary a famous, important, or inspirational person.
refulgent shining brilliantly; radiant.
sententious using or marked by pompous, high-flown moralizing.
shibboleth a slogan, phrase, or belief that characterizes or is held devotedly by a group.
